Understanding Agentic Loop Failures in Production AI Systems
A comprehensive framework for identifying and resolving recurring issues in autonomous artificial intelligence systems has emerged following extended operational periods. This taxonomy categorizes common failure patterns, provides debugging methodologies, and outlines architectural adjustments necessary for maintaining long-term reliability in production environments.
The rapid adoption of autonomous artificial intelligence systems has shifted engineering focus from initial prototype development to long-term operational stability. As these systems transition from experimental environments into active production pipelines, engineers encounter a distinct set of challenges that emerge only after sustained deployment. Understanding the underlying mechanics of system degradation requires a structured approach to identifying failure patterns. This analysis examines the recurring issues that arise within autonomous decision-making cycles and outlines practical strategies for maintaining reliability over time.
A comprehensive framework for identifying and resolving recurring issues in autonomous artificial intelligence systems has emerged following extended operational periods. This taxonomy categorizes common failure patterns, provides debugging methodologies, and outlines architectural adjustments necessary for maintaining long-term reliability in production environments.
What constitutes the agentic loop in production environments?
Autonomous systems operate through continuous cycles of reasoning, action, and observation. Each iteration requires the model to interpret incoming data, select appropriate tools or actions, and evaluate the resulting state. This recursive process forms the foundation of modern agentic architectures. The loop must function reliably across diverse inputs and unpredictable external conditions. Engineers must design these cycles to handle ambiguity without collapsing into unproductive patterns.
The architecture relies heavily on state management and context preservation. Every step within the cycle depends on accurate memory of previous outcomes. When the system loses track of its operational history, subsequent decisions become misaligned with initial objectives. Maintaining coherent state across thousands of iterations demands robust serialization and synchronization mechanisms. Without these safeguards, the loop drifts from its intended trajectory.
Production environments introduce variables that rarely appear during development. Network latency, rate limiting, and external service updates alter the behavior of connected tools. The system must adapt to these fluctuations while preserving its core objectives. Engineers observe that successful loops incorporate explicit validation steps before committing to irreversible actions. This precautionary design prevents minor deviations from escalating into systemic failures.
The mechanics of autonomous reasoning cycles
Reasoning cycles function as the cognitive core of autonomous operations. Each cycle processes raw inputs through structured planning stages before executing tool calls. The quality of the reasoning directly determines the reliability of the output. When planning stages skip critical validation steps, the system generates actions that lack necessary context. Engineers must enforce strict sequencing rules to ensure each cycle completes its full evaluation before proceeding.
Why do autonomous systems degrade after extended deployment?
Environmental drift represents the most persistent challenge in long-term operation. External APIs evolve, data formats shift, and user interactions change over time. The system that functioned flawlessly during initial testing gradually encounters unfamiliar inputs. This gradual mismatch causes performance to decline in ways that are difficult to detect during controlled evaluations. Continuous monitoring becomes essential to identify these subtle shifts before they impact downstream processes.
Context window limitations further complicate sustained operation. As the system accumulates information across numerous iterations, it must decide which details warrant retention and which can be discarded. Poor compression strategies lead to the loss of critical instructions or constraints. When essential context disappears, the model begins generating actions that contradict established parameters. Engineers must implement dynamic summarization techniques to preserve operational integrity.
Tool execution reliability deteriorates when error handling remains superficial. Autonomous agents frequently encounter malformed responses, timeout conditions, and authentication failures. Systems that treat these events as terminal rather than recoverable quickly enter failure spirals. Implementing exponential backoff, fallback routing, and explicit retry logic transforms transient errors into manageable exceptions. This resilience allows the loop to continue functioning despite external instability.
Environmental drift and state management challenges
State management requires careful balancing between memory retention and computational efficiency. Engineers design systems to archive historical context while pruning irrelevant details. When pruning algorithms remove essential constraints, the system loses its ability to maintain operational boundaries. Regular audits of state compression algorithms help preserve critical information across extended deployment periods.
How can engineering teams systematically diagnose loop failures?
Effective debugging requires granular visibility into every step of the decision cycle. Engineers must capture structured logs that record input states, model reasoning traces, tool call parameters, and output results. Without this level of detail, identifying the precise origin of a deviation becomes nearly impossible. Comprehensive tracing allows teams to reconstruct the exact sequence of events leading to a breakdown. This reconstruction forms the basis for targeted architectural improvements.
Isolation testing provides a reliable method for verifying component behavior. Engineers can extract problematic sequences and replay them against controlled datasets to confirm whether the issue stems from the model, the tool integration, or the environment. This separation of concerns prevents misattribution of faults. When teams isolate variables systematically, they can apply fixes without introducing new instability into the broader pipeline.
Feedback mechanisms must be designed to correct rather than amplify errors. When the system receives negative outcomes, it should adjust its subsequent actions based on explicit signals. Vague or delayed feedback causes the loop to repeat the same mistakes. Engineers implement structured reward signals and penalty thresholds that guide the model toward more reliable strategies. This continuous calibration reduces the frequency of recurring failures over time.
Observability and traceability in complex workflows
Traceability demands that every decision point generates a verifiable record. Engineers build logging pipelines that capture intermediate states alongside final outputs. These records enable post-mortem analysis without requiring real-time intervention. When teams establish consistent tracing standards, they create a reliable foundation for continuous improvement and iterative refinement.
What architectural patterns reduce long-term operational risk?
Modular decomposition separates complex workflows into discrete, testable units. Instead of relying on a single monolithic loop, engineers design specialized components that handle planning, execution, and verification independently. This separation allows teams to update individual modules without disrupting the entire system. When a failure occurs, it remains contained within a specific segment rather than cascading across the pipeline.
Human oversight mechanisms provide a necessary safety net for high-stakes operations. Automated systems should route uncertain or high-impact decisions to human reviewers before execution. This hybrid approach balances efficiency with accountability. Engineers configure threshold-based triggers that determine when human intervention becomes mandatory. The system continues operating autonomously for routine tasks while preserving human control for critical junctures.
Continuous evaluation frameworks replace static testing with ongoing performance monitoring. Teams deploy automated benchmarks that run alongside production traffic to detect regression early. These benchmarks measure accuracy, latency, and constraint adherence across thousands of daily interactions. When performance dips below established baselines, the system triggers alerts or initiates controlled rollbacks. This proactive stance prevents minor degradation from becoming major operational disruptions.
Implementing continuous evaluation frameworks
Evaluation frameworks require careful calibration to avoid false positives. Engineers design metrics that distinguish between acceptable variance and genuine failure. Automated scoring systems compare live outputs against historical baselines to identify meaningful deviations. When evaluation criteria align with operational goals, teams gain actionable insights that drive sustainable system improvements.
The transition from experimental prototypes to reliable production infrastructure requires a fundamental shift in engineering priorities. Teams must prioritize observability, modular design, and continuous evaluation over initial development speed. By acknowledging the inevitable challenges of environmental drift and context management, organizations can build systems that maintain stability across extended operational periods. The focus now rests on implementing rigorous monitoring practices and iterative refinement cycles that adapt to evolving requirements.
What's Your Reaction?
Like
0
Dislike
0
Love
0
Funny
0
Wow
0
Sad
0
Angry
0
Comments (0)